The cheapest way to get from Niles to Biloxi is to drive which costs $160 - $240 and takes 15h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Niles to Biloxi is to fly which takes 6h 35m and costs $130 - $550.
No, there is no direct bus from Niles station to Biloxi. However, there are services departing from Harlem Station and arriving at Biloxi via Jefferson Park Transit Center, Chicago Bus Station, Atlanta Bus Station and La Grange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 26h 42m.
No, there is no direct train from Niles to Biloxi. However, there are services departing from Jefferson Park and arriving at Biloxi Amtrak Sta via Chicago Union Station and New Orleans Union Passenger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 24h 1m.
The distance between Niles and Biloxi is 832 miles. The road distance is 913.5 miles.
The best way to get from Niles to Biloxi without a car is to train which takes 24h 1m and costs $320 - $750.
It takes approximately 6h 35m to get from Niles to Biloxi, including transfers.
Niles to Biloxi b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Chicago Bus Station.
Niles to Biloxi train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Chicago Union Station.
The best way to get from Niles to Biloxi is to fly which takes 6h 35m and costs $130 - $550.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$320 - $750 and takes 24h 1m, you could also bus, which costs $180 - $340 and takes 26h 42m.
